Management Commentary

During the accompanying earnings call held shortly after the release was published, SNYR leadership focused their remarks largely on ongoing operational restructuring initiatives that were implemented over the course of the previous quarter. Management noted that the negative EPS figure for the quarter was primarily tied to one-time, non-recurring costs associated with portfolio optimization efforts, including adjustments to the company’s product lineup and streamlining of back-office operational functions. Leadership did not address the absence of reported revenue data in significant detail during the call, only noting that additional financial disclosures related to top-line performance may be included in future public filings as the company completes its ongoing operational assessment of business segments. No specific comments on individual product performance or customer metrics were shared during the call, per available transcripts. Forward Guidance

Synergy CHC Corp. did not issue formal quantitative forward guidance alongside its the previous quarter earnings release, per published materials. Leadership stated on the call that the firm is prioritizing finalizing its restructuring roadmap before sharing specific financial projections with the public, and that investors could possibly expect updates on operational milestones in upcoming public communications over the next several months. Analysts tracking the company have noted that the lack of formal guidance is consistent with SNYR’s recent communication approach as it navigates shifts in the broader consumer health market and internal operational adjustments. Management added that any future guidance shared would likely be tied to measurable progress on cost reduction targets that were initiated during the previous quarter, as the firm works to align its expense structure with its long-term strategic goals. Market Reaction

In the trading sessions immediately following the release of SNYR’s the previous quarter earnings results, the stock saw mixed price action with slightly above average trading volume in the first two days post-release. Analysts covering the firm have noted that the reported negative EPS figure was roughly aligned with broad market expectations that had been circulated among institutional investors in recent weeks, which may have muted extreme volatility following the announcement. Some market observers have highlighted that the absence of reported revenue data has created lingering uncertainty among some retail investors, which could potentially contribute to higher than usual volatility for SNYR in the coming weeks until additional clarity is provided. Broader sector sentiment for small-cap consumer health stocks may also influence SNYR’s price action in the near term, alongside any additional operational updates the company chooses to release related to its restructuring progress. Market participants are also likely to monitor upcoming regulatory filings from the firm for any additional details on the previous quarter revenue performance that were not included in the initial earnings release.
